PSYC 128 SC - Abnormal Psychology


This course will focus on the description of abnormal behavior in human beings and the various theoretically based explanations for it, both past and present. Intervention strategies relevant to the prevention or reduction of psychological suffering due to different disorders will also be explored. 

Prerequisite(s): PSYC 052 
Instructor: J. LeMaster
Course Credit: 1.0
Offered: Annually
